Set in 17th-century Puritan Massachusetts, The Scarlet Letter tells the haunting story of Hester Prynne, a woman condemned to wear a scarlet "A" for committing adultery. As Hester endures shame and isolation, she raises her daughter Pearl and protects the identity of the child’s father, the respected Reverend Dimmesdale. Nathaniel Hawthorne’s powerful exploration of guilt, sin, and redemption probes the heart of moral hypocrisy and human frailty. A foundational work of American literature, The Scarlet Letter remains a timeless meditation on the complexities of judgment, punishment, and forgiveness.
